What is the meaning of the name Dariya?

The name Dariya is primarily a female name of Slavic – Ukraine origin that means Possessing Good.

The name “Dariya” is of Slavic origin and is commonly used in several Slavic languages. It has a specific meaning in these languages.

The name “Dariya” is derived from the Slavic word “dar,” which means “gift.” Therefore, “Dariya” can be interpreted to mean “gift” or “gifted.” It is a feminine given name and is often associated with positive qualities, indicating that the person is a precious or gifted individual.

As with many names, the interpretation and cultural significance of “Dariya” may vary based on regional and familial preferences within Slavic-speaking countries. It is appreciated for its meaning of “gift” and is a relatively common name in Slavic cultures.

How to write the name Dariya in Japanese?

To write the name “Dariya” in Japanese, it would be transcribed into Katakana, which is the script used for foreign words and names. The transcription is based on the phonetic sounds of the name. The name “Dariya” in Japanese Katakana would be ダリヤ (Dariya).

Here is the breakdown:
– ダ (Da)
– リ (ri)
– ヤ (ya)

Katakana script is used to approximate the pronunciation of non-Japanese names as closely as possible within the constraints of Japanese phonetics. In this case, “Dariya” is adapted to fit the closest corresponding sounds available in the Japanese language.
